Building and Planning
About the Department
The Building and Planning Department is a unit within the Town's Department of Public Works. The Senior Planner ensures that all building construction in the Town is in compliance with applicable building, safety and zoning regulations. The planning staff reviews proposed construction projects for conformity with the Town's Comprehensive Plan and overall community development goals. This department staffs the Planning Board, Zoning Board of Appeals, Conservation Board, Architectural Review Board, and the Historical Preservation Commission.

Building Code
The Town of Brighton has adopted the New York State Uniform Fire Prevention and Building Code with additional town requirements for sprinklers.
Zoning Code
The Town of Brighton Code includes the Comprehensive Development Regulations which controls land use and development.
- Zoning Applications include Planning Board (PB), Zoning Board of Appeals (ZBA), Architectural Review Board (ARB), Historic Preservation Commission (HPC), Sign Review, and Certificate of Compliance (C of C). See 'Applications and Forms' below or contact Building and Planning staff.
